Obituary for Deleta D. "Dee" Caylor (Robertson)

Deleta D. “Dee” Caylor, 76, of Paradise Lake, Effingham, KS died on Sat. April 30, 2016 at the Mosaic Life Center, St. Joseph MO.

Funeral services will be 10:00 am on Wednesday, May 4th, 2016 at the Becker Chapel, Effingham, KS with Rev. Jeff Cochran officiating. Burial will follow in the Lancaster Cemetery, Lancaster, KS. The family will receive friends from 6:00 to 8:00 pm on Tuesday, May 3rd, 2016 at the Becker Chapel, Effingham. Memorial contributions are suggested to American Cancer Society and may be sent in care of the funeral home. Condolences to the family may be left online at www.beckerdyer.com.

Dee was born on Aug. 5, 1939 in Lockwood, MO the daughter of Earl and Allene (Lockmiller) Robertson. She attended schools in Lamar, MO. Dee had worked at Atchison Leather Products, she and her husband owned and operated the former “Ellie’s Deli, Atchison for several years and they managed the Best Western Motel in Atchison for 12 years. She was a member of Effingham Union Church, Effingham, KS and enjoyed making ceramics, reading, gardening and raising flowers, baking, and candy making. She especially enjoyed her family and grandchildren.

She was married to William G. Caylor on June 28, 1953 in Lamar, MO. Mr. Caylor preceded her in death on June 24, 2015. Survivors include a son, Bill (Sissie) Caylor Everest; daughter, Cindy (Thomas) Jones, Leavenworth, KS; seven grandchildren, Brian (Sara) Caylor, Brandon(Ashley) Caylor, Adam Caylor, Ben Dodge, Rusty Sullivan, Denise and Tabetha Jones; six great grandchildren, Lola, Elijah, Amaya, Zoey, Abby and Tyler; a sister, Earlene Rawlings, Lamar, MO; several nieces, nephews, cousins and special niece, Janice Dunlap, Spartanburg, SC. and sister-in-law, Betty Caylor, Parsons, KS. Her parents, husband Bill, and two sisters, JoAnn Leahman and Joyce Cook, preceded her in death.
